Skills

  • IEP Development & Management: Expert knowledge of writing, implementing, and monitoring Individualized Education Programs (IEPs)
  • Behavioral Interventions: Proficiency in Positive Behavioral Interventions and Supports (PBIS) as well as creating Functional Behavior Assessments (FBA)
  • Differentiated Instruction: Ability to modify lesson plans and materials to meet diverse learning styles and abilities
  • Legal Compliance: Understanding of federal and state laws, including the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) and Section 504
  • Curriculum Adaptation: Modifying general education curriculum to make it accessible for students with various disabilities
  • Patience & Empathy: Crucial for building rapport and remaining calm during challenging behavioral moments
  • Adaptability & Flexibility: The ability to pivot teaching strategies mid-lesson if a student becomes frustrated or disengaged
  • Collaboration: Working effectively with general education teachers, therapists (OT/PT/SLP), and parents in a multidisciplinary team
  • Crisis De-escalation: Staying composed and using verbal or physical techniques to manage student crises safely
  • Active Listening: Essential for understanding student needs that may not be expressed verbally
  • Social-Emotional Learning (SEL): Implementation of curriculum like Zones of Regulation or Second Step
  • Perspective Taking: Helping students understand "the hidden rules" and others’ thoughts/feelings
  • Pragmatic Language Support: Coaching students on the nuances of social communication
  • Executive Functioning Coaching: Supporting students with organization, emotional regulation, and task initiation
  • Generalization Training: Ensuring students can use social skills in the community, not just the classroom
